Comprehending the Key Types for Hyundai i10
Before diving into the replacement process, it is important to understand the types of keys related to the Hyundai i10. There are typically two types of keys:
| Key Type | Description |
|---|---|
| Traditional Key | A basic metal key with no electronic components. |
| Transponder Key | A key that contains an embedded chip, communicating with the car's ignition system for included security. |
Key Identification
Determining which type of key you have is crucial as it considerably impacts the replacement process. Many Hyundai i10 models feature transponder keys, which are more secure but likewise more complicated and pricey to replace.
How to Obtain a Replacement Key
1. Calling Your Hyundai Dealership
The first suggestion for obtaining a replacement key is to contact your local Hyundai dealer. They have access to your vehicle's key codes and can develop an exact duplicate or a brand-new transponder key.
Actions:
- Provide Vehicle Information: Be all set to offer your lorry recognition number (VIN) and other individual recognition information.
- Key Code Requirement: For transponder keys, the dealer needs the key code that is usually kept in your car's records.
- Cost Estimate: Asking for a price quote prior to checking out will avoid any surprises.
| Service | Timeframe | Approximated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Key Duplication (Traditional) | 1 Hour | ₤ 5 - ₤ 15 |
| Transponder Key Replacement | 1 - 2 Hours | ₤ 100 - ₤ 300 |
2. Professional Locksmith
If going to a car dealership isn't practical, another option is to employ a professional locksmith. Numerous locksmith professionals concentrate on vehicle keys, including transponder keys for automobiles like the Hyundai i10.
Steps:
- Research Local Locksmiths: Look for certified and insured locksmith professionals who have great evaluations.
- Confirmation of Skills: Ensure they have the necessary devices to cut and set transponder keys.
- Cost Check: Obtain a quote before continuing, as rates can differ.
| Service | Timeframe | Estimated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Standard Key | 30 - 60 Minutes | ₤ 5 - ₤ 15 |
| Transponder Key Replacement | 1 Hour | ₤ 50 - ₤ 150 |

Factors Influencing Key Replacement Cost
- Key Type: Traditional keys are more economical to replace compared to transponder keys.
- Lorry Model & & Year: Newer designs generally have more complex keys and key systems.
- Labor Charges: Dealerships and locksmiths have various labor expenses depending upon geographic place and knowledge.
- Additional Features: Keys with remote entry features or integrated key fobs might sustain greater replacement costs.
Often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. How much does a replacement key for a Hyundai i10 cost?
A replacement key can range in between ₤ 5 for a traditional key to ₤ 300 for a transponder key depending on the approach and place.
2. Can I program the key myself?
Setting a transponder key normally requires special equipment and can be complicated. It is normally advised to have an expert manage this process unless you have access to the needed tools.
3. What should I do if I've lost all my keys?
If all keys are lost, the very best option is to contact the dealership for a replacement. They can create a new key from the vehicle's VIN.
4. Is it safe to buy a key online?
Buying keys online can be risky. Guarantee that keys work with your vehicle and be careful of prospective scams. It's frequently best to buy through authorized dealers or professional locksmith professionals.
5. What info do I need to offer to get a replacement?
You will typically require your car identification number (VIN), proof of ownership (like a title or registration), and identification.
